Have you patched IE with the MSXML patch? >From msdn.microsoft.com follow the link and instructions. hth lee "Soria, Oscar" wrote: > > Hello! > > I have an XML file and another one XSL. I haven't achieved to open the > XML file with Internet Explorer 5 and to see its datas. The XML file > point to XSL. > > The content of the XML is: > > <?xml version="1.0" ?> > <?xml-stylesheet type="text/xsl" href="prueba1.xsl"?> > <employee id="03432"> > <name>Joe Shmo</name> > <title>Manager</title> > </employee> > > And of the XSL: > > <xsl:stylesheet xmlns:xsl="http://www.w3.org/1999/XSL/Transform" > version="1.0"> > <xsl:template match="/"> > <html> > <body> > <p> > <b> > <xsl:value-of select="employee/name"/> > </b> > <xsl:text>: </xsl:text> > <xsl:value-of select="employee/title"/> > </p> > </body> > </html> > </xsl:template> > </xsl:stylesheet> > > When I open the XML file and IE5 open it, the result in the explorer is: > > : > > IE5 don't read the data of the XML file and I don´t know why!
